This role is located in Marchwood, within the Cawood Scientific Environment Division. Marchwood, part of Cawood, was established in 1998 and performs a range of specialist analytical testing services to customers operating in the Environmental, Industrial and Agricultural Sectors from its three laboratories based in the South and North of England. As a leading UK Dioxin and Furans analysis laboratory and the UK’s leading specialist laboratory for independent occupational hygiene analysis, Marchwood offers a range of services for the environmental, occupational and food/feed sectors. At the heart of Cawood is NRM, the UK’s leading agricultural laboratory, founded in 1990. The Cawood group was formed in 2006 with the acquisition of the animal feed testing business, Sciantec. Since then, we have grown rapidly through our strong relationships with customers, our ongoing investment in people and equipment, and the acquisition of businesses that complement or expand our services. This development has allowed us to increase our range of services and extend our reach into global markets. In 2021, Cawood was acquired by US corporation Ensign-Bickford Industries (EBI), becoming a member of its Agriculture and Environmental Diagnostics Group.
